Button Control
The buttons are used to control the calibration settings. Follow the bottom line on
the display to determine the functions in the different modes. The three
combinations that are available are left only, right only, or both. To select the center
option on the bottom line of the display, press both buttons together.
Calibration Menus
The calibration mode allows the board to be setup with min and span points as well
as all of the other configuration information applicable depending on the
configuration switch settings.

The calibration is performed by first calculating the expected settings for the
calibration resistors before entering the calibration operation to get a good starting
point. Then the 0 point is adjusted to the minimum point in the ADCC (memory
chip). The span temperature is then set and the span gain is adjusted to make the
span point 1/8 of the entire range for the temperature measurements.

Calibration is performed by setting the gain of the span circuit to minimal gain then
adjusting the 0 point to the minimum reading from the ADCC. The span temperature
is used to measure the ADCC value and calculate the step size of the ADCC.
